Happy Retirement, Bill Pumphrey!

Bill has volunteered for more than six years and logged over 5200 hours with the Clinton School and the Clinton Presidential Center. He has been a tremendous help during countless public programs and he’s been a huge part of many students’ lives.

Fall 2013 Capstone Projects

The projects are part of the school’s Capstone program, which requires individual students to work with community leaders to help build healthy, engaged and vibrant communities and demonstrate their ability to work effectively in public service.
